Video Podcasting for Beginners will help you break into the world of podcasting using Video interviews or calls you do on skype, zoom or any platform. We will help you leverage your video as well as audio content to make sure it gets as much distribution as possible such as on Youtube, Stories, Spotify, Itunes, Amazon music, and more.
- Learn the Gear to Produce professional high quality Video podcasts
- Get Audio tips for producing high quality audio
- Learn how to extract audio from a video track
- Learn two methods to publish and distribute your audio podcast to the major platforms like spotify, itunes, and amazon music.

Hi! I was born in South Africa but as a child my family relocated to Canada and lived most of adult life in beautiful British Columbia. I remember getting a VHS camcorder and would make and direct my own home videos with my sisters. I attended Simon Fraser University (SFU) with a Communications degree and had another opportunity to film an educational hip-hop video for earth quakes. After I graduated university I went on to have a successful IT career working 13 years in the field.As an IT manager I went onto pursue my MBA at SFU and found inspiration to start my own business and travel and film.By the time I had completed my MBA in 2011 I had found my passion travel, business, and filming.
During a wild and intense 3-year period I sold my house and purchased a camera and traveled the globe with my camera in search of adventure. I traveled to places such as Beijing, Singapore, Shanghai, The Grand Canyon, and Turks and Caicos. During this period a new revolution with the SLR camera was allowing people to create cinema quality video. I spent countless hours trying to learn everything I could from the best to hone my craft.I currently have over 100 videos on youtube and have one of the strongest travel video collections on the Internet.
